The Genialba LCD writing tablet 2-pack gives kids ages 3 to 8 a pair of 12-inch drawing boards that work with a simple press of a stylus or fingernail. Each screen shows colorful lines, no blue light or glare, and the lock button stops accidental wipes. The set comes in blue and green.

What Makes the Genialba Tablet Safe for Kids' Eyes?

The LCD screen uses no blue light, no glare, and no radiation. This design helps protect young eyes during long drawing sessions. Many parents worry about screen time, but this doodle pad avoids the common issues of phones or tablets.

How Long Does the Battery Last?

The built-in battery lasts about six months and supports up to 100,000 writes. It can be replaced when it runs out, and no charging or plugging is needed. That means less waste and more drawing.

Built Tough for On-the-Go Fun

The plastic case is lightweight and durable. It's waterproof and anti-fall, so drops or spills don't ruin it. Kids can take it in the car, on a plane, or to a restaurant. It fits in a school bag or handbag. The tablets encourage creativity without the mess of traditional art supplies, making them ideal for travel or quiet time.

How Does the Pressure-Sensitive Drawing Work?

Press lightly for thin lines, harder for thicker ones. The stylus, a fingernail, or any hard object works. It feels like writing on paper. The erase button clears everything with one tap. The lock key prevents erasing until unlocked, so masterpieces stay safe. This simple technology lets kids focus on creating.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Can I use my finger or a pen cap to draw? Yes, any hard object works.
  • Does the screen show many colors? It shows colorful lines, but not a full color range; the line color depends on pressure.
  • What if my child accidentally clears the screen? The lock key prevents that. Just lock before play.
  • Is the tablet safe for a 3-year-old? Designed for ages 3-8, with a durable, child-friendly build.
